**Runbook 4.2 — Restoring sweeper access after account lockout**

If the Hollowtide retention sweeper's service account is locked, do not recreate it; retention schedules are bound to the account ID. Verify the lockout in the audit pane, confirm no sweep is mid-cycle, then open the recovery console. The console will prompt for the sweeper's recovery passphrase, which is:

strongbox words: wenix-ulador

Ticket PULSE-412: WebSocket reconnect loop in Glimmerline staging. After a deploy, clients reconnect every 4 seconds because the auth handshake fails silently — the staging env file was copied from dev and is missing the gateway signing secret, so tokens never validate. Please verify the loadout before restarting workers. Add the following line to staging's .env file.

vault entry, yahif-yajep: COURIER_KEY29=b802bdf8034096b65a51c6ba5abe2

## Service Accounts — Flaky Integration Tests (Ledgerline Payments)

The `payct-ci` service account keeps hitting rate limits mid-suite, causing intermittent 429s in the settlement integration tests. Root cause: shared account across three pipelines. Fix in flight: dedicated account per pipeline, owned by the Ledgerline team. Until merged, retries are capped at two and the nightly run is pinned to off-peak. To reproduce locally against the staging gateway, authenticate the `payct-ci` account with the key below.

gateway credential: kto23_LX9A4ys6i4nzHtpOLNLodKK

## Evacuation-Chair Store — Contractor Note

The evacuation-chair store at Bramwell Court is on each stairwell landing, level 3 and above. Do not block these doors with equipment or materials. Chairs must be returned after drills. Access for inspection works is via the keypad; the current code is below.

door code, kawip-bagap: bdg-HQEWH-4